The Itinerary Breakdown

Start Point & Meeting Logistics
The tour begins at Pítko Malostranská in Malá Strana, a charming neighborhood close to public transportation, making it easy to reach. You’re advised to arrive 15 minutes early—not just to meet the guide but also to ensure you don’t miss the tram ride that takes you into the castle complex. Since the group exits either inside or near Golden Lane, the tour concludes conveniently within Prague Castle grounds.

Stops & Highlights

  • St. Vitus Cathedral:
    You won’t go inside on this tour, but the exterior alone is awe-inspiring. This Gothic masterpiece dominates the skyline and is a key symbol of Prague. For those wanting inside access, the tour recommends a full Prague Castle experience, but this quick exterior view sets the scene perfectly.
    Reviewers note that guides often share fascinating stories about the cathedral’s history, making the exterior visit enriching.

  • Old Royal Palace:
    Hear about the Second Prague Defenestration, a pivotal moment in Czech history, while admiring the Gothic architecture. The focus here is on storytelling rather than inside visits, so expect a quick but engaging stop.

  • Third Castle Courtyard:
    Offers a perfect vantage point for photos of St. Vitus, and your guide will highlight the buildings where Czech Presidents work—an authentic glimpse of modern political life intertwined with medieval grandeur.

  • St. George’s Basilica:
    As the oldest standing church in Prague, its exterior is striking, with two towers that tell tales of medieval architecture. The guide’s stories help bring the building’s history alive.

  • Golden Lane:
    This tiny street is packed with legends of alchemists who aimed to turn metals into gold—stories that enchant visitors of all ages. You’ll also see Kafka’s former home, making this a highlight for literature fans. The guide’s narration turns a simple walk into a compelling story about Prague’s mystical side.

  • Second Courtyard & Presidential Residences:
    A short stop to view where the Czech President greets dignitaries, with stories about Leopold’s Fountain and the Presidential Flag.

What the Tour Includes (and What it Doesn’t)

Guides are certified and knowledgeable, often sharing captivating stories that go beyond basic facts. The tour fee covers their expertise, but you’ll need to purchase a tram ticket (around 30 CZK or €1.20) at the meeting point to reach the castle—the only extra cost to consider. The tour’s small group size—up to 8 travelers per booking—ensures a more personal experience, with plenty of room for questions and photo stops.
